Gold spotted oak borer larvae feed beneath the bark, cutting off nutrient transport and killing healthy oak trees within two to four years of attack. Trunk injection delivers systemic insecticide directly into the vascular tissue, circulating throughout the canopy and root zone to prevent egg laying and larval establishment. Treatment must occur before visible symptoms appear, when the tree’s defenses remain strong enough to uptake and distribute the active ingredient.

Look for dark staining or weeping sap on the trunk, large patches of missing bark, woodpecker damage, and crown dieback starting from the top down. Larvae create tunnels under the bark that disrupt water flow.
Coast live oak, California black oak, and Canyon live oak are the primary targets. Drought-stressed trees are especially vulnerable. Healthy oaks in quarantine zones should still be treated preventively before symptoms appear.
If caught early and treated before the galleries girdle the trunk, yes. Once crown dieback exceeds sixty percent or bark loss is severe, survival rates drop sharply. Preventive treatment before visible damage offers the best outcome.
Fall through early winter, before adult beetles emerge in summer. Treatment applied during dormancy allows systemic uptake throughout the vascular tissue. Treating after an active infestation is visible requires immediate intervention regardless of season.
Systemic trunk injection typically provides protection for one to two years, depending on tree size and health. Annual monitoring is recommended in high-risk zones. A follow-up treatment schedule will be customized based on your tree’s condition.
